Have you installed DirectX 9? If so, the Windows XP
firewall, DirectX 9, Messenger and the
firewall have issues working together, which can display
the behavior you're seeing. You may
need to turn the firewall off totally, or if you want to
continue using it, turn off the
firewall, load Messenger and then turn the firewall back
on.

To turn it off (and on), click Start, then click the
Control Panel. If you're in category
view click Network and Internet connections then click
Network Connections. Right click the
network or dialup connection, then click Properties.
Click the Advanced Tab, and you will
see the option to turn off/on the Internet Connection
Firewall.

To remove DirectX 9, just use System Restore, click Start,
then Help & Support, then "Undo
changes to my computer using System Restore" and restore
back to before DirectX 9 was
installed.
